Inishtimahon: 'The Island of the Mc Mahons'

Inishtimahon cottage has a spacious ground floor kitchen/living/dining area, fitted with a kitchen with electric cooker and grill, microwave oven and all necessary cooking and dining equipment. The room has pine table, chairs and dresser, the back door opens to a barbeque area. There is a 3 seater sofa bed, 1 two seater sofa and 2 arm chairs, the sofa bed is suitable for sleeping 2 extra persons, the area is also fitted with a pellet burning stove room heater. All bedrooms are on the ground floor, 2 rooms with king & single beds with en-suite and 1 double bedroom with king size bed with bathroom. The twin rooms with en-suite are wheelchair accessible. The cottage has an oil fired central heating system and a solar panel to assist with heating domestic water. The cottage is in the grounds of An Creagán with a wide range of activities and events for all the family.
